Method and apparatus for determining phase fractions of multiphase flows

    Abstract: A multiphase meter for use in the quantification of the individual phase fractions of a multiphase flow has: a resonant cavity through which, in use, a multiphase fluid flows, a signal generator configured to apply electromagnetic energy at a range of frequencies to the cavity, and an enhancing and/or suppressing facility for enhancing and/or suppressing resonant modes of a signal produced resultant to the application of electromagnetic energy to the cavity.
